Locating Your Perfect Participants: A Guide to UX Research Recruitment

Securing the right individuals for your UX research investigation is crucial for gathering valuable data. To secure this, consider these tips: clearly define your target audience. Create a detailed persona that outlines their attributes. Utilize diverse recruitment methods, such as online communities, social media, or industry-specific networks. Be transparent about the objectives of your research and offer participants for their time and input. Always obtain informed consent and ensure your research is responsible with industry standards.

Optimizing UX Through Constructive Participant Feedback

In the dynamic world of user experience (UX) design, gathering and implementing participant feedback is crucial for creating intuitive and engaging products. Specific feedback provides designers with valuable insights into user needs, pain points, and preferences. By Analyzing this feedback, designers can Recognize areas for improvement and make data-driven decisions to Optimize the UX.

Integrating participant feedback effectively involves several steps. Firstly, it's important to Gather feedback from a diverse range of users through methods such as user testing, surveys, and focus groups. Next, designers should Categorize the feedback based on common themes and priorities. , Additionally, it's essential to Communicate the findings with stakeholders and involve them in the decision-making process.

, Consequently, by Utilizing actionable participant feedback, designers can create UX designs that are more user-centric, efficient, and enjoyable.
